Preguntas frecuentes sobre North Park
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en North Park?
Actualmente hay 1,940 Apartamentos Estudios en North Park con alquileres que van desde $1,350 hasta $3,348, con un precio medio de $2,387.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en North Park?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en North Park varian entre $1,500 y $7,112 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,845
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en North Park?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en North Park van desde $1,845 hasta $10,315.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,990
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en North Park?
En estos momentos hay 345 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en North Park en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$3,050 y $17,230 - con una media de $5,191 para el lugar.
